首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将JSON文件加载到JS对象中

,可以通过以下几个步骤实现:

  1. 使用XMLHttpRequest或Fetch API来获取JSON文件。这可以通过发送HTTP请求到JSON文件的URL来完成。在前端开发中,通常会使用AJAX来实现这一步骤。
  2. 使用响应对象的responseTextresponse属性来获取返回的JSON数据。这里需要注意的是,响应数据会以字符串的形式返回。
  3. 使用JSON.parse()方法将获取到的JSON字符串转换为JavaScript对象。JSON.parse()是JavaScript内置的方法,它将JSON字符串解析为对应的JavaScript对象。
  4. 现在,你可以通过访问解析后的JavaScript对象来获取JSON数据中的内容,并在应用程序中进行处理或展示。

下面是一个示例代码,演示了如何将JSON文件加载到JS对象中:

代码语言:txt
复制
// 创建XMLHttpRequest对象
var xhr = new XMLHttpRequest();

// 发送GET请求,获取JSON文件
xhr.open('GET', 'path/to/your/json/file.json', true);
xhr.setRequestHeader('Content-Type', 'application/json');

xhr.onreadystatechange = function() {
  if (xhr.readyState === 4 && xhr.status === 200) {
    // 获取返回的JSON数据
    var jsonResponse = xhr.responseText;

    // 将JSON字符串解析为JavaScript对象
    var data = JSON.parse(jsonResponse);

    // 现在可以访问data对象中的数据了
    console.log(data);
  }
};

// 发送请求
xhr.send();

上述代码中,path/to/your/json/file.json需要替换为你要加载的JSON文件的实际路径。在请求完成后,通过xhr.responseText获取返回的JSON字符串,然后使用JSON.parse()方法将其解析为JavaScript对象。

对于腾讯云的相关产品推荐,可以使用腾讯云的对象存储服务 COS(Cloud Object Storage)。COS是一种安全、高可靠、低成本的云存储服务,支持存储和访问任意类型的文件和数据。你可以通过以下链接了解更多关于腾讯云 COS 的信息:

腾讯云对象存储(COS)官方产品介绍链接:https://cloud.tencent.com/product/cos

希望以上信息对你有帮助!如果你有其他问题,欢迎继续提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券